Deputies of Supreme Rada ARC have addressed to People’s Deputies with the request to approve the bill «About modification of point 4 of section V»Final provisions»of the Law of Ukraine« About immigration ». Such decision is accepted at plenary session of parliament of an autonomy on June, 16th. The given decision was supported by 77 members of parliament from 96 voting.
In particular, the Crimean members of parliament suggest to add final provisions of the law with the paragraphs providing the right of unobstructed immigration of persons which in 1941-1944 have been deported from places of constant residing to a national sign (the Crimean Tatars, Armenians, Bulgarians, Greeks, Germans and persons of other nationalities).
Besides, the right to immigration is received subjected to repression which in the subsequent have been rehabilitated, and also by members of their families and descendants who come back to a constant residence to Ukraine.
Deputies believe that bill acceptance will allow to defuse tensions existing in a society and to provide unobstructed entrance on territory of Ukraine of the deported citizens to an ethnic sign and before the subjected to repression persons.
As the author of the project of the decision deputy Remzi Iljasov has acted.
